Transaction

e95eee85eecdff8a42864ad032bb681fbbe816decdeaa64ea1db90f69d524f8a
173,310 confirmations
Timestamp
1668776086
Block763,713
Fee8,440 sats
Fee rate40.2 sats/vB
view on mempool.space

Inputs & Outputs